Japan – Indonesia’s Tangguh Expansion Project Commences LNG Shipment

We, the joint venture partners of the Tangguh LNG Project led by bp, the project operator, are pleased to announce that the new liquefaction train (Train 3) of the Tangguh Expansion Project in Papua Barat Province, Indonesia, has started commercial operation and first shipment of liquefied natural gas (LNG) produced by Train 3 has safely sailed from the Tangguh site. The Tangguh Expansion Project’s Train 3 adds a production capacity of 3.8 million tons of LNG per annum (MTPA) to the existing Tangguh facility, which consists of two trains with a combined production capacity of 7.6 MTPA. Seeing Indonesia’s sports tourism development through Lake Toba F1 Powerboat Championship

In developing its sports tourism potential, Indonesia holds many championships or sports events, and one of the closest is the F1 Powerboat (F1H2O) World Championship in Lake Toba, North Sumatra, on February 24-26. Lake Toba, one of the most spacious lakes in the world, offers a great destination for athletes to compete, and tourists to enjoy the scenic view.
